    Abstract: A quantum-cryptographic-communication system according to an embodiment includes a key-integrated-management device, quantum-cryptography devices, and key-management-inspection devices. An inspection-target-value-calculating unit calculates an inspection-target value based on quantum-cryptography-device information related to a quantum-cryptography device. An expected-value-calculating unit calculates an expected value based on at least one of wiring information of a QKD link connected to the inspection-target-quantum-cryptography device; weather information of the site installed with the inspection-target-quantum-cryptography device; and the quantum-cryptography-device information. A permissible-value-calculating unit calculates a permissible value based on at least one of the wiring information, the weather information, and the quantum-cryptography-device information.

    Abstract: Provided is a work processing apparatus configured so that limitations on the contents of processing for a work piece or the type of work piece can be reduced and processing for a wider range of processing contents and work piece can be performed. In a work processing apparatus 100, a work table 101 is, through a table displacement mechanism 103, supported on a rotation base 120 to be rotatably driven by a table rotary drive motor 125, and a weight holding tool 110 is supported on the rotation base 120 through a weight displacement mechanism 114. The table displacement mechanism 103 includes a rack-and-pinion mechanism configured to displace the work table 101 in an X-axis direction as viewed in the figure. At the table displacement mechanism 103, a power inputter 108 configured to input drive force from a table displacement mechanism drive apparatus 130 is provided.

    Abstract: A liquid crystal device includes a liquid crystal layer, and an inorganic oriented film between the liquid crystal layer and an electrode, in which the inorganic oriented film has a first inorganic oriented film that has a first prismatic structure including silicon oxide, and a second inorganic oriented film that is formed so as to cover at least a portion of the first prismatic structure, and includes nitrogen.

    Abstract: A running control function of a motorcar is inspected on an inspecting apparatus which is provided with rolls for mounting thereon each of wheels of the motorcar. The control function operates to control rotational speeds of wheels depending on a difference in rotational speed between front and rear wheels or right and left wheels of the motorcar. The motorcar is caused to run in a condition in which each of the wheels of the motorcar is mounted on each of the rolls. When a rotational speed of a first roll for mounting thereon one of front and rear wheels or one of right and left wheels and a rotational speed of a second roll for mounting thereon the other of the front and rear wheels or the other of the right and left wheels have both increased to a predetermined speed, the first roll is decelerated.

    Abstract: A limited slip differential which is incorporated into a differential gear for driving one wheel and the other wheel of a vehicle is inspected as follows. One wheel and the other wheel are mounted on one roll and on another roll, respectively. Acceleration of the vehicle is performed while the aforementioned one roll on which the aforementioned one wheel is mounted is being subjected to a force of restraining the rotation of the aforementioned one roll. A difference in rotational speed between the aforementioned one roll and the aforementioned another roll on which the other wheel is mounted is measured during the accelerating operation. A torque which operates on the aforementioned one roll is measured. A limited slip differential torque which is generated by the limited slip differential is measured from the measured torque.

    Abstract: Method and apparatus for adjusting tension on a timing belt of an engine. The engine includes a driving pulley on its crankshaft, a driven pulley on its camshaft, an auxiliary pulley, a timing belt bridging over the pulleys and a tension pulley pressing against the belt at one side. The driving pulley is first reversely rotated while the driven pulley is held fixed in position thereby tensioning the portion of the belt between the auxiliary pulley and the driven pulley. The driving pulley is then rotated normally to overtension the tension side portion of the belt while the tension pulley is advanced to take up any slack. Thereafter, the tension pulley is retracted while the driving pulley is reversely rotated until deflection of the tension side portion of the belt reaches a predetermined target adjustment value. The tension pulley is then fixed in position.
